Am I a good candidate for rhinoplasty?

You may be a candidate for rhinoplasty (nose reshaping) if you feel like your nose is cosmetically unattractive or does not “fit” with other facial features, and/or if you have trouble breathing through your nose. Rhinoplasty may also be indicated for abnormal appearance of the nose as a result of birth defects, injury, or disease.

What can rhinoplasty correct?

Nose reshaping is intended to produce a more attractive and proportional nose. Rhinoplasty can:

  • Reduce the size & reshape a nose that is too large for the face
  • Reduce the size of a nose bridge that is too wide for the face
  • Straighten out a prominent bump on the nose bridge
  • Reduce the size of an overly long nasal tip
  • Reshape a too-round or bulbous nasal tip
  • Restore symmetry to a nose damaged from injury
  • Reduce the appearance of very prominent nostrils
  • Improve one’s ability to breathe if the septum obstructs normal breathing

How is nose reshaping surgery performed?

Dr. Movassaghi performs surgery at McKenzie Surgery Center or Sacred Heart Medical Center in Eugene, Oregon. Rhinoplasty is done on an outpatient basis under sedation and local anesthesia or general anesthesia. Depending on the corrections to be made, Dr. Movassaghi will employ one of the following surgical techniques”

  • Standard or “Closed” Rhinoplasty. Incisions are made inside the nostrils. The nasal bones, cartilage, and soft tissues are reshaped to improve the external contour.
  • Open Rhinoplasty. Frequently used for difficult or larger noses. Involves one external incision across the columella (strut between the nostrils). Bones, cartilage, and soft tissues are reshaped under direct vision.
  • Tiplasty. If only the nasal tip is abnormal, it may be corrected with either a standard or external (open) approach.
  • Septoplasty. Dr. Movassghi may perform septoplasty during nose surgery to correct a deviated septum and improve breathing.
  • Large nostrils may be reduced through tiny incisions at the outer base of the nostrils with either type of rhinoplasty.

What is recovery like from nose reshaping?

Following your procedure, you will go home with an external cast or splint in place, which is usually removed in 7 to 10 days. The nose may be packed with gauze for 24 to 48 hours. Initial discomfort is easily controlled with oral medication.

The majority of swelling and bruising subsides progressively over 2 to 4 weeks. External sutures (if any) are removed in 4 to 6 days. Internal sutures will dissolve. Patients are typically ready to return to daily activities after about 7 to 10 days, and exercise can gradually be resumed about 3 weeks after surgery, although contact sports should be avoided for a while longer.

When will I notice my results?

Since reshaping the nose involves repositioning cartilage and, in some cases, bone, bruising, and swelling are common, which can initially obscure the results. The majority of any swelling and bruising will dissipate after about 2-3 weeks, at which point most patients feel comfortable going out in public. Others may notice that you look a little different than you used to, but should not notice you have had surgery unless you tell them.

The semi-final result of rhinoplasty is evident in about 3 months, although subtle improvements will continue for up to 1 year after your procedure.

Will insurance cover rhinoplasty?

Rhinoplasty is not covered by insurance if being done for cosmetic reasons. If however, the nasal deformity is due to a recent injury, insurance coverage may be available. Pre-authorization information can be obtained from your insurance company.
